Matapédia
Matapédia is a municipality in Matapédia Valley area of the Gaspé Peninsula in eastern Quebec. It sits on the banks of the Restigouche River along the New Brunswick border.Places of Interest

Matapédia station
Railway station

Matapédia station is a Via Rail station in Matapédia, Quebec, Canada. Matapédia is the junction between two rail lines. The east-west former Intercolonial Railway mainline from Halifax to Rivière-du-Loup is joined from the east by a line running along the south coast of the Gaspé Peninsula to the town of Gaspé.
